Vancouver, on Canada’s West Coast, is one of the world’s most beautiful cities. With its mild climate and stunning location between the North Shore Mountains and the Pacific Ocean, Vancouver offers the perfect blend of natural beauty, year-round outdoor activities and urban excitement. For spectacular scenery, cycle or stroll the seawall and take in the stunning beauty of Stanley Park or relax at one of Vancouver’s many beaches. You can wander through historic Gastown, hike or snowboard the trails of Grouse Mountain or shop at one of our downtown malls. Toronto is the fourth-largest city in North America and the heart of Canada’s business and cultural life. This inviting, cosmopolitan city offers everything that a world class city should: culturally diverse neighborhoods offering cuisine from around the world, exciting nightlife and major sporting events with exceptional art, music and cultural opportunities. Stroll along the Lake Ontario waterfront, explore Yonge Street (the world’s longest street), shop at one of the huge shopping malls or attend the Toronto International Film Festival. General English The Teachers At Eurocentres Canada, our team of qualified and experienced teachers is committed to your learning success. Varied and systematic teaching plans derived from the Eurocentres curriculum incorporate your learning needs and accelerate your progress.

Level Assessment and Progress On your first day you will be tested on grammar, writing, speaking and listening so that you will be placed in a class suited to your level. During your course your progress is assessed through regular testing by your teachers. As you progress, you will change classes to ensure that you are always in the most suitable class for your level.

Each language course is based on the Basic (Core Program) Course of 20 morning lessons per week. The Basic Course develops all aspects of your language competence in a personalized program coordinated by your core teacher. Courses integrate grammatical structures and functions, guided conversations, pronunciation, speaking, listening, reading, writing and vocabulary in order to advance your communicative competency in all skill areas and to ensure a balance of fluency and accuracy. It includes 2-3 Study Club sessions per week plus 5 hours selfstudy in the Learning Centre.

University and College Pathway Program University Pathway Program This program provides a solid foundation in English Language for Academic Purposes in order to prepare you for study at one of our partner Post-Secondary Institutions. You will have 48, 36, 24 or 12 weeks of English language training (Specialized Intensive or Specialized Super-Intensive Course) in which you will learn and develop your English and academic skills and be provided with the tools needed for success in a Canadian university or college. From beginning to end, our Pathway Coordinator will be there to provide information, support, guidance and counseling. Upon successful completion of your English course, you will have met the English language requirements for a variety of partner Canadian universities and colleges, eliminating the need for an institutional exam (i.e. IELTS, TOEFL, etc.). During the post-secondary portion of your program, you will have the opportunity to study at one of our partner post-secondary institutions where you will work towards earning a certificate, undergraduate degree or post-graduate degree in one of a variety of academic disciplines. Pathway Career & Co-op Program Pathway Career & Co-op Program - General Language Practicum The purpose of this program is to provide you with the necessary English Language skills needed to successfully complete your career training program. You will gain a solid foundation, specializing in English for Academic Purposes. When you enrol in the Pathway Career and Co-op Program, you will take 12, 24, or 36 weeks of English language training in our Specialized Intensive or Specialized Super-Intensive Course, depending on your English Level. Upon successful completion of your English course, you will meet the English language requirements of our partner institutions (Sprott Shaw College or Evergreen College). During the English language training part of the program, you will learn the skills necessary for academic success by studying and practicing contextual English. You will focus on: note-taking, lecture summarizing, research and presentation techniques, critical thinking skills, essay writing, examination techniques, tutorial and seminar participation, debating, and basic English skills (vocabulary, writing, speaking, and reading). During the career training portion of your program you will have the opportunity to study at Sprott Shaw College in Vancouver or Evergreen College in Toronto. Here you will be able to work towards earning a certificate or a diploma. In this part of the program you will have the opportunity to gain valuable work experience at a Canadian company.

Accommodation Homestay, residence and other accommodation options are offered through our unparalleled Accommodations Program. All host families and residences have been carefully inspected and are monitored on an on-going basis by our onsite Accommodations Coordinators to guarantee students a positive experience wherever they choose to stay.

Residences

Homestay

Other Accommodation Arrangements

Qualified and welcoming families provide students with private rooms, a place to study and the experience of living with a Canadian family. Students have the option of full or half board. We adhere to a policy of one student per language per home. All of our host families have been carefully selected and counselled on welcoming international students into their families. We carefully monitor our homestay program to guarantee that all students have positive experiences and during the first week of school alone, we check in with students on three occasions to ensure that they are happy with their family.
